Cheek to Cheek is bringing the DasArts Feedback Method to Malta: a tool of great benefit to artists who are constantly seeking collaborative environments, and who are embedded in devised works.
The tool supports a non-defensive discussion in relation to artistic works-in-progress. Led by a belief that we can learn a great deal from each other as artists, this is a horizontal tool which does not necessitate a hierarchy. The scope is to postpone harsh criticism whilst allowing the feedbacker to enter somebody else’s artistic work in a graceful manner.
The process will consist of two 2-day workshops in January and April, followed by the possibility of a longer workshop culminating in a theatre creation in June 2022. Workshops on the feedback tool will be led by Manolis Tsipos - a performance maker, performer and writer, based in Amsterdam.
